Output 3ed4ecfaefe1e27d8a89993fbf462dadf6256fa6a0b10a614d2fde16688e7e2b:0

value
36511362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d20ed3cc88aa667f39631723a97c8358a5aa3b OP_EQUAL
address
34gZBmB4g2ziLXmv3z6cxH83hb2GXebMKY
transaction
3ed4ecfaefe1e27d8a89993fbf462dadf6256fa6a0b10a614d2fde16688e7e2b